I got a private lead today for 10 - 15 hours of audio. I have not recorded anything this long before, so wanted to get some pricing ideas.

Looking at the V123 pricing guide...to me it looks like 10 hours would be about $12000...could that be right?

I used this as a guide:
All Others:
Per minute of audio delivered:
US Dollars

Each additional minute
over 60 minutes: 20

So, $20/minute...10 hours would be $12000. Is this standard...or will I scare the bejeezes out of the client?

Nice score, Julie.
That quote will flush the client.
You're talking quantity here, though, so you can discount accordingly.

When you say 10-15 hours audio, is that finished or your total recording time?

To my thinking, if it's finished, figure three times that for recording and editing...45 hours. You can probably live with a $75/hour rate, which brings us to, oh, let's say $3400.

Now, is the client directly making money on this? Is it for broadcast of some sort?
If not, I'd throw in a low-scale buyout of 50% for a nice round total of $5,000, including retakes.
If yes, the buyout is 150% for a nice, round $7500.

But that just my take.
